What is the NVFlare Tool Assembly?
NVFlare is an open-source federated learning framework developed by NVIDIA. It focuses on privacy preservation and supports popular machine learning and deep learning frameworks. NVFlare provides tools for secure provisioning, orchestration, and monitoring of federated learning workflows, making it suitable for secure, privacy-preserving collaborations in distributed AI research.
What can you use the NVFlare Tool Assembly for?
- Privacy-preserving federated learning
- Secure orchestration and monitoring of FL workflows
- Support for popular ML/DL frameworks
Limitations/Remarks
- Implementation challenges in domain-specific applications
- Requires familiarity with NVIDIA ecosystem for optimal use
Specific Use Cases/Applications
- Secure AI research collaborations across distributed setups
- Healthcare, finance, and other privacy-sensitive domains
How to access the NVFlare Tool Assembly?
- Official Documentation
- GitHub Repository
- Install via pip:
pip install nvflare
References
Original Framework Contributors
- NVIDIA
- NVFlare Community
For a full list, see the NVFlare GitHub contributors.